Compare all specifications:

2003 MCC Smart 1996 Xedos 6
Make MCC Xedos
Model Smart 6
Year Released 2003 1996
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1499 cc 1598 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 106 HP 106 HP
Torque 145 Nm 138 Nm
Drive Type Front Front
Transmission Type Automatic Automatic
Vehicle Weight 975 kg 1140 kg
Vehicle Length 3760 mm 4570 mm
Vehicle Width 1690 mm 1710 mm
Vehicle Height 1460 mm 1360 mm
Wheelbase Size 2510 mm 2620 mm
